In a world where everything seems perfectly logical and pragmatic. The thought of anything existing outside of the realm of what one already knows seems impractical. That is how Melinda Morrison sees life. The very life where she has shared nearly every waking moment with her childhood to adulthood best friend Andrew Jackle was the center of her entire existence. It was how she expected it to remain as well until both of their lives are unexpectedly taken from them on what was seemingly a random day. Thurst into the body of an infant of all things, Mellie now has to learn once again how to live life, this time in a completely different world with different cultures and structures. But to make matters worst, she has no idea where Andrew is! Though somehow he returns to her in the most unpredictable form. A prince?! Follow the journey of the two fated friends in their pursuit of navigating a world seemingly light years away from their original. Will they be able to pull through and make the best of their particular situation? Or will they fall into the sea of celestials once again forced to find each other in another lifetime?
